2015-01-21 65 views
0

我试图测试出的Twitter卡,无法弄清楚。我复制了他们的一个例子,只是改变了目标链接,所以它会链接到我的网站。我创建了这个快速示例网站进行测试:http://www.canvasmagazine.tk/index.htm/叽叽喳喳卡不验证

当我到微博卡验证器,它不断返回相同的错误。

错误:FetchError:超过4.seconds到Portal.Pink构造函数,safecore同时等待的请求的响应,其中包括重试(如适用)(卡错误)

于是我拿出其中的CSS有自定义字体和背景,并会减慢运行时间。但我仍然收到同样的错误。我也来回更改元数据从名称到财产,然后将其与上述结合起来,但仍然没有运气。希望这是明显的我失踪了。任何帮助,将不胜感激。

<meta property="twitter:card" content="summary_large_image"> 
<meta property="twitter:creator" content="@Environmentnyou"> 
<meta property="twitter:domain" content="http://canvasmagazine.tk/index.htm"> 
<meta property="twitter:title" content="Canvas Magazine | "> 
<meta property="twitter:description" content="test"> 
<meta property="twitter:image" content="http://canvasmagazine.tk/images/tile.jpg"> 

编辑:我也尝试关闭“/>”每个元标记而不是“>”,但这没有什么区别。

EDIT2:已解决。 Twitter已经阻止了我的服务器。

+0

请发帖回答你的问题,而不是编辑,问题解决到问题本身。这样,人们就不会跳过潜在有用的建议,因为他们认为这个问题从未解决。 – 2015-02-27 15:42:09

回答

0

我得到这个问题,我们无法弄清楚这个问题。但是我发现了某些可能对您有帮助的故障排除步骤。

  1. 检查robots.txt并确保允许user-agent: twitterbot。有时,Twitter会阻止阅读此文件的元数据。

  2. 检查叽叽喳喳服务器的IP地址是否未被主机阻止。这些是由Twitter使用的IP地址:

    199.59.148.209
    199.59.148.210
    199.59.148.211
    199.16.156.124
    199.16.156.125
    199.16.156.126

    (来源:https://dev.twitter.com/cards/troubleshooting

    此外,Twitter的ASNUM是AS13414。

  3. Apache的.htaccess文件否认requests.You可以通过打开.htaccess文件,并寻找类似检查了这以下内容:

    来自199.59.149否认*

按照上面提到的故障排除步骤,让我们知道如果适合你!

感谢,

拉克什索兰奇